Creativity overflows into groundbreaking designs as Management and Science University (MSU) students unleash their artistic talents. The university becomes a canvas for graphic design students where inspiration meets innovation. Nasuha Binti Ahmad Shukri, currently pursuing her sixth semester in Bachelor in Graphic Design (Hons) from the Faculty of Information Sciences and Engineering (FISE), has found her passion for visual storytelling amplified by MSU’s vibrant creative environment.
Nasuha has always been attracted to the influence of visuals while thinking back on her path towards graphic design. From doodling in her youth to honing her skills as a student at MSU, Nasuha's love for art has always been clear.
The university's resources were vital in improving her abilities. The cutting-edge software in design at MSU's modern facilities empowers students like Nasuha to innovate and explore. Enrolling in courses on publication design, animation, and UI/UX design has expanded Nasuha’s creative abilities and capability to craft captivating visual narratives.
The designer has faced obstacles on their journey, even the talented one. “One of my biggest struggles was dealing with creative blocks,” Nasuha admitted. Yet, MSU’s emphasis on fostering inspiration through workshops, exhibitions, and visits to art galleries provided Nasuha with the motivation she needed.
Another challenge was confidence. “Presenting my designs was daunting at first. I worried about criticism,” Nasuha said. Nevertheless, Nasuha’s instructors and friends provided helpful criticism, turning negative feedback into a chance for improvement. The assistance I've gotten at MSU has been amazing—it has enabled me to fully immerse myself in my work and present it with certainty," Nasuha added.
Nasuha’s goals are as bold as her designs. She dreams of working with global companies, creating visual designs that leave a lasting impact. With a strong portfolio built at MSU and hands-on experience gained through exhibitions and competitions, Nasuha is steadily moving toward making that dream a reality.
Nasuha's motivation and inspiration are drawn from the ever-changing environment at MSU. The university presents endless opportunities to show off Nasuha’s work and build powerful connections within the creative community. “MSU isn't just a place of higher learning; it is the place where Nasuha’s vision as a designer actually came alive. This is where I found the confidence to turn my passion into something tangible," Nasuha shared.
The advice from Nasuha for individuals considering taking graphic design is simple and valuable: “Creativity serves as more than just a form of self-expression—it is a true vocation. Through grit, creativity, and conducive surroundings, they are shaping not just their destinies but also a heritage of motivation.”
